In humans the genetic commonality of height and skin tone is that they are both
lubasha [3.4K]

Answer:

In humans the genetic commonality of height and skin tone is that they are both <u>Polygenic Traits.</u>

Explanation:

Polygenic traits can be described as those characteristics for which there is more than one gene to determine its inheritance. The outcomes of polygenic genes result in many differentiated phenotypes. For example, the difference in height, the difference in skin colour etc.

Polygenic traits occur because one allele for a gene does not have complete dominance over the other gene. This is termed as incomplete dominance. Incomplete dominance is a Non- Mendelian trait as Mendelian traits showed one allele to be completely dominant over the other allele.
